Growth Metrics

Star Bulk Carriers (SBLK) Beginning Cash Balance (2023 - 2024)

Historic Beginning Cash Balance for Star Bulk Carriers (SBLK) over the last 2 years, with Q1 2024 value amounting to $121.2 million.